在本篇博文中,主要学习一下STING聚类算法。 (1) STING:统计信息网格 STING是一种基于网格的多分辨率的聚类技术,它将输入对象的空间区域划分成矩形单元,空间可以用分层和递归方法进行划分。这种多层矩形单元对应不同的分辨率,并且形成了一个层次结构:每个高层单元被划分成低一层的单元。关于每个网格单
转载
2023-09-28 01:15:20
489阅读
一、算法简介Affinity Propagation聚类算法简称AP,是一个在07年发表在Science上的聚类算法。它实际属于message-passing algorithms的一种。算法的基本思想将数据看成网络中的节点,通过在数据点之间传递消息,分别是吸引度(responsibility)和归属度(availability),不断修改聚类中心的数量与位置,直到整个数据集相
# 使用 Twisted 实现简单的网络应用
在这篇文章中,我们将学习如何使用 Python 的 Twisted 框架来实现一个简单的网络应用。Twisted 是 Python 中一个非常强大且灵活的异步网络框架,能够帮助你轻松实现各种网络协议和应用。
## 实现流程
下面是整个实现的流程,可以帮助你更清晰地理解步骤:
| 步骤 | 描述
原创
2024-10-24 04:20:13
82阅读
应用场景聚类系数在学术上的应用定义可以参考 Wiki 的 Small-World-Network, 基于经典的社交 6度分隔网络为起点, 延伸来做复杂分析, 引入了过多其他的图论概念, 这里不详细描述, 感兴趣可自行了解.聚类系数在实际生产环境应用和三角计数比较相似(通常是结合选一个), 全图聚类系数可以用于判断图的稀疏, 稠密, 用得不多, 更多的是用于局部范围来分析某个点/子图的紧密
集群计算实际上不能真正地被看作是一种分布式计算解决方案。不过对于理解网格计算与集群计算之间的关系是很有用的。通常,人们都会混淆网格计算与基于集群的计算这两个概念,但实际上这两个概念之间有一些重要的区别。 网格是由异构资源组成的。集群计算 主要关注的是计算资源;网格计算 则对存储、网络和计算资源进行了集成。集群通常包含同种处理器和操作系统;网格则可以包含不同供应商提供的运行不同操作系统的机器。(I
在这个博文中,我们将深入探讨 Python 中的贪婪算法运用。贪婪算法是一种用于解决最优化问题的有效技术,它通过选择当前最优解而忽略后续可能性,从而迅速达到近似最优解。本文将通过详细的背景描述、技术原理、架构解析、源码分析、性能优化及扩展讨论,帮助大家更好地理解贪婪算法在 Python 中的应用。
## 背景描述
贪婪算法的历史可以追溯到20世纪50年代。它逐渐演变出多种形式,广泛应用于算法竞
1,向函数传递数组#!/bin/bash/
#
declare -a UIDS=(`awk -F: '{print $3}' /etc/passwd`)
function GETSUM() {
declare -i SUM=0
declare -i I=0
declare -a MYIDS=($@) //向函数传递数组
while [ $I -lt ${#MYIDS[*]} ];
原创
2013-07-24 14:53:13
879阅读
/// /// 索引的创建与更新 /// public class IndexManager { public static readonly IndexManager Instance = new IndexManager(); private static readonly string IndexPath = Ho...
原创
2021-07-30 09:24:51
147阅读
在Python编程中,“强转sting”通常意味着将不同数据类型转换为字符串类型。本文将对此过程进行详细分析,以帮助读者深入理解Python的类型转换机制。
随着编程语言的发展,Python的类型系统也经历了多次变革。从早期的Python 2.x版本到后来的3.x版本,类型转换的方式和规则都有所变化。**适用场景分析**:在数据处理、文本分析或用户输入时,我们往往需要将数字、列表或其他对象转换为
K-近邻算法概念K-近邻算法(K-Nearest Neighbor)即K个最近的邻居。通俗地讲,要评价你是什么样的人,只需要看看你周围的朋友都是什么样的人便知道了。这与“鱼找鱼,虾找虾,乌龟找王八”都是想通的,相近似的事物总会聚在一起。将这种判断模式抽象为数学模型,就转化为一个距离计算问题。KNN是最简单的机器学习算法之一,属于有监督算法,用于分类任务。k-近邻算法的原理给定一个训练样本数据集,其
目录一、贪心算法理论基础(必看)(1)贪心算法(greedy algorithm)概念(2)贪心算法的基本要素二、贪心算法题目(Python、C++、C、JAVA实现)(1)初级贪心算法(LeetCode 455.分发饼干为例)(2)进阶贪心算法(待完善)(1)高阶贪心算法(待完善)三、贪心算法、动态规划、标准分治算法比较(拓展) 一、贪心算法理论基础(必看)(1)贪心算法(greedy alg
转载
2023-11-07 15:28:23
2阅读
# 使用Python进行字符串聚类的指南
字符串聚类是数据分析和自然语言处理领域的一项重要任务。它可以帮助我们理解数据中隐藏的模式和结构。在这篇文章中,我将引导你通过一个完整的流程来实现字符串聚类。在开始之前,我们首先列出实现的步骤。
## 实现流程
| 步骤 | 描述 |
|-------------|---------------
Python日期 时间的使用时间格式在Python中,通常有这几种方式来表示时间:1)时间戳; 2)格式化的时间字符串; 3)元组(struct_time)共九个元素。1)时间戳(timestamp)的方式:通常来说,时间戳表示的是从1970年1月1日00:00:00开始按秒计算的偏移量。我们运行“type(time.time())”,返回的是float类型。返回时间戳方式的函数主要有time()
转载
2024-01-30 05:24:18
79阅读
VRRP简介
通常,同一网段内的所有主机都设置一条相同的、以网关为下一跳的缺省路由。主机发往其他网段的报文将通过缺省路由发往网关,再由网关进行转发,从而实现主机与外部网络的通信。当网关发生故障时,本网段内所有以网关为缺省路由的主机将无法与外部网络通信。这样缺乏冗余性。
缺省路由为用户的配置操作提供了方便,但是对缺省网关设备提出了很高的稳定性要求。增加出口网关是提高系统可靠性的常见方法,此时如何
原创
2012-03-13 23:52:18
10000+阅读
## JAVA运用ActiveX控件的实例
作为一名经验丰富的开发者,我将指导你如何在JAVA中运用ActiveX控件。首先,让我们来看整个过程的流程图:
```mermaid
gantt
title JAVA运用ActiveX控件的实例流程图
section 准备工作
下载ActiveX控件库 :done, des1, 2021-10-01, 1d
原创
2024-06-24 03:47:57
106阅读
1、string 是C++中的字符串。 字符串对象是一种特殊类型的容器,专门设计来操作的字符序列。 不像传统的c-strings,只是在数组中的一个字符序列,我们称之为字符数组,而C + +字符串对象属于一个类,这个类有很多内置的特点,在操作方式,更直观,另外还有很多有用的成员函数。 string ...
转载
2016-01-10 11:43:00
74阅读
# Redis 和 MySQL 的运用实例
## 引言
在现代互联网开发中,Redis 和 MySQL 是两种广泛使用的数据库系统。Redis 是一个高性能的键值存储数据库,适合缓存和快速存取数据;而 MySQL 则是一个关系型数据库,适合存储结构化数据。在许多应用场景中,我们可以将这两者结合使用,从而更好地提高数据存取效率和应用性能。
这篇文章将指导你如何实现一个简单的 Redis 和 M
8_info表中使用一个16位的无符号整数来记录字符串...
原创
2022-06-10 14:05:18
122阅读
关于九种数据类型,在之前的文章中我们已经全部介绍,接下来,我们就将跳出基础知识的教学,进入到Python程序编写的学习,
原创
精选
2024-07-16 10:35:12
170阅读
KNN算法的简单运用 最简单的KNN算法 import pandas as pd import numpy as np df = pd.read_excel('./datasets/my_films.xlsx',engine='openpyxl') feature = df[['Action Len ...
转载
2021-09-01 20:27:00
86阅读
2评论